Stitches, when combined with others, create stitch names such as the Catherine Wheel Stitch, Granite Stitch, Suzette Stitch, Jasmine Stitch, and many more. Since 2008, The Crochet Crowd has been filming many of the combinations and are in tutorial format.

Below is a master list connected to a tutorial. Most tutorials are in left- and right-handed format. The left-handed version is linked in the video descriptions and/or pinned comments of a tutorial.

The list connected with YouTube Videos is in alphabetical order. Some stitches have multiple names but are the same things, such as the Linen Stitch, Granite Stitch and Moss Stitch. Some stitches go out of trend and come back as a new name. If you are looking for a master list of Abbreviation Terms with Tutorials, you can also find it on our site.
